The "Games" Landscape: What's Trending Right Now?

Several key trends are dominating the gaming conversation this week. Expect to see increased focus on:

  • Indie Game Darlings: Smaller studios continue to release innovative and compelling titles, often pushing the boundaries of genre conventions. Keep an eye out for surprise hits that gain traction through word-of-mouth and streaming.
  • Esports Expansion: Esports events are drawing bigger crowds and offering larger prize pools than ever before. Major tournaments are attracting mainstream attention, with increasing viewership and sponsorship deals.
  • Mobile Gaming Dominance: Mobile "Games" remain a powerhouse, with new titles consistently topping download charts. The accessibility and convenience of mobile gaming make it a popular choice for players of all ages.
  • Nostalgia Wave: Remakes, remasters, and retro-inspired titles are seeing a resurgence in popularity, tapping into players' fondness for classic "Games."
  • Live Service "Games": Games that are constantly evolving with new content, events, and features are dominating the landscape and playerbase.

Deep Dive: "Games" and Community

"Games" aren't just about playing; they're about connecting with others. Online multiplayer "Games" have created vibrant communities where players from around the world can interact, collaborate, and compete. This sense of community can be incredibly rewarding, fostering friendships and shared experiences.

However, online communities can also have their downsides. Toxicity and harassment are unfortunately common problems in some gaming environments. It's important to remember to be respectful to others online and to report any instances of abuse.

Ninja (Richard Tyler Blevins):

  • Who is Ninja: Richard Tyler Blevins, better known as Ninja, is an American streamer, YouTuber, and professional gamer. He gained prominence playing Fortnite, becoming one of the most recognizable figures in the gaming world.
  • Biography: Ninja was born on June 5, 1991, in Detroit, Michigan, and grew up in the Chicago suburbs. He began gaming competitively in Halo 3, later transitioning to streaming and playing games like H1Z1 and PlayerUnknown's Battlegrounds (PUBG) before achieving widespread fame with Fortnite. His engaging personality and high skill level helped him amass millions of followers across various platforms, including Twitch and YouTube. In 2019, he made headlines by signing an exclusive streaming deal with Mixer, Microsoft's now-defunct streaming service, before returning to Twitch in 2020.
